logo elektroda
logo elektroda
X
logo elektroda
REKLAMA
REKLAMA
Adblock/uBlockOrigin/AdGuard mogą powodować znikanie niektórych postów z powodu nowej reguły.

EasyJailbreakBatch Tool: Automatyzacja jailbreaka iOS z redsn0w i iTunes

zeezoo 28 Maj 2011 16:37 6153 3
REKLAMA
  • Witam serdecznie.

    Kiedys troche sie nudzilem i zrobilem takie male narzedzie ulatwiajace zrobienie jailbreaka w iPhonie, iPodzie oraz iPadzie 1.

    Narzedzie samo pobiera potrzebne pliki zarowno redsn0w jak i odpowiedni iOS. Mozna tez ustawic recznie katalog, w ktorym mamy pliki ipsw jesli wczesniej je pobralismy. Oczywiscie jesli sa one w domyslnym katalogu iTunes program rowniez je znajdzie i uzyje. Jesli jakikolwiek plik ma nieprawidlowy rozmiar program usunie go i pobierze nowa kopie prosto z serwera apple.
    Wrzucilem programik na z-franka, cieszy sie dosc duza popularnoscia, wiec wydaje mi sie, ze kazdemu sie przyda. Czesto nie wiemy jaka wersje redsn0w uzyc. Ten malutki batch zrobi wiekszosc za nas :)

    Pozdrowienia.
    zeezoo

    changelog:

    1.4

    -hosts file editor added
    will check if gs.apple.com line exist in hosts file and if not will add otherwise will ask to remove it.
    after any operation will ping gs.apple.com to test if it's changed correctly.
    after first run will make backup of hosts file, can be restored any time

    1.3

    changes:
    -batch didn't work properly if Windows was non-english language. That's fixed now.
    -batch is using latest redsn0w_win_0.9.6rc17 for 4.3.3 firmware
    anyway you can still use rc16 if you use manual mode
    -added option to start redsn0w manually
    of course if it's not on the hdd will download selected version
    -added option to set ipsw folder manually
    if you have ipsw files downloaded already and you don't want to move them to ipsw folder just type c [enter] and set the correct folder
    That will be saved in config file to use in the future. Of course can be changed anytime.

    version 1.2 available.

    changes:
    -added support for iPod 2G 4.2.1
    -added support for iPod 3G 4.2.1/4.3.1/4.3.2/4.3.3
    -added support for iPod 4G 4.2.1/4.3.1/4.3.2/4.3.3
    -added support for iPad 1 4.2.1/4.3.1/4.3.2/4.3.3

    1.1

    - I didn't notice before that iTunes keeps only the latest software in default ipsw folder. From now my program is checking default folder and if it doesn't find correct file it will check ipsw folder located in iPhone folder on desktop and if it doesn't find it there it will get it from apple server.
    To get new executable please use upd8.exe or type "u" in batch window and press enter. Anyway program will show that there is update available and give you instructions.

    1.0 initial version

    - iPhone iOS supported models and versions
    2G 3.1.2/3.1.3
    3G 4.2.1
    3GS 4.2.1/4.3.1/4.3.2/4.3.3
    4 4.2.1/4.3.1/4.3.2/4.3.3
    -f0recast version 1.2

    download:
    upd8.exe will download always the latest version. Then use exe file from iPhone folder on your desktop.
    Załączniki:
    • upd8.zip (278.11 KB) Musisz być zalogowany, aby pobrać ten załącznik.
    O autorze
    zeezoo
    Poziom 26  
    Offline 
    zeezoo napisał 984 postów o ocenie 19, pomógł 77 razy. Mieszka w mieście Ostrow Wielkopolski. Jest z nami od 2005 roku.
  • REKLAMA
  • #2 9611583
    zeezoo
    Poziom 26  
    Posty: 984
    Pomógł: 77
    Ocena: 19
    version 1.5 available

    -iOS 5b1 support added for:
    iPhone 3GS
    iPhone 4
    iPod Touch 3G
    iPod Touch 4G
    iPad 1
    [tethered jb only]

    -program will check for update once a day, not everytime when opened/closed

    -some little changes in code - should work faster now

    !!!CAUTION!!!:

    STRONGLY advise - please download ipsw files manually [torrent?] and put them in iPhone/ipsw folder or custom folder. My script is using imzdl.com server to get required ipsw but unfortunately this server is very busy and most of the time it's not working properly.

    version 1.6 available

    fixes
    - iPhone 3G 4.2.1 and 3GS 4.2.1 didn't work properly. That's fixed now.
    - there was a little problem if date was in different format than yyyy/mm/dd
    now should work fine even if it's dd-mm-yyyy

    new
    - micro Apache web server added for following phones:
    iPhone 3G 4.2.1
    iPhone 3GS 4.2.1,4.3.1,4.3.2,4.3.3

    It will save you time and bandwith. You just have to put iPad1,1_3.2.2_7B500_Restore.ipsw in ipsw folder. If you don't have that file on you hdd script will get it for you automatically.
    And then...
    1. Will add special line in hosts file - it will be deleted when redsn0w operations are finished.
    2. Will download micro Apache from my server with all required settings.
    3. micro Apache server will start on port 13000 (if this port is used with another application will not work properly - please let me know if you have any problems with that. I will change it to different one)
    4. Script will start rinetd service to bind port 80 to 13000. If you see any errors please let me know. In my case there was a problem with teamviewer on one of 5 computers which I've used for tests. I've closed it any works fine.
    5. redsn0w will start and will think that is downloading iPad baseband from appldnld.apple.com but it will be your private http server
    6. After redsn0w finished work hosts file will be restored and micro Apache server will be terminated.
    You and your files are safe

    to update please type u and press [enter] from main menu.

    Have fun and please report any errors. It was fully tested on 3 computers with Windows XP but it should work on Win7/Vista as well. I will test it later on today.

    Best regards
    zeezoo
  • REKLAMA
  • #3 9930456
    slawko_k
    Poziom 35  
    Posty: 2926
    Pomógł: 253
    Ocena: 234
    Cytat:
    upd8.exe will download always the latest version. Then use exe file from iPhone folder on your desktop


    Gdzie znajduje się ten exe file from iPhone folder on your desktop? bo ja na pulpicie nie mam nic takiego.
  • #4 9933485
    zeezoo
    Poziom 26  
    Posty: 984
    Pomógł: 77
    Ocena: 19
    slawko_k napisał:
    Cytat:
    upd8.exe will download always the latest version. Then use exe file from iPhone folder on your desktop


    Gdzie znajduje się ten exe file from iPhone folder on your desktop? bo ja na pulpicie nie mam nic takiego.


    To zalezy gdzie zainstalujesz. Standardowo jest to pulpit. Powinien byc tam folder "iPhone", a w nim EasyJailbreakBatch.exe i tego exe'ka uzywasz do uruchomienia programu.

    To najnowsza wersja upd8.exe, w ktorej jest instalator z mozliwoscia wyboru folderu, w ktorym chcesz zainstalowac aplikacje:
    http://www.mediafire.com/download.php?6uio2zc8ofotexo

    W razie problemow pisz.

    Pozdrowienia
    zeezoo
REKLAMA